Trulite Glass & Aluminum Solutions’ 3000 Resistor Hurricane Impact Storefront is engineered, designed and tested in accordance with the demanding Standards of Miami-Dade County (NOA) and the Florida Building Code (FBC). The 1-1/4″ x 4-1/2″ systems are available in shear block assembly and are ideal for single span Impact Resistant storefront applications. The 3000 series is glazed with 9/16 ” laminated glazing infill. The center glazed 3000 series can be either inside or outside glazed lending itself to the varying needs of our customers. Trulite’s 351 Impact Resistant entrances are easily integrated into these systems. Trulite has the unique ability to produce and furnish the complete impact resistant system and glazing, which is an added convenience for the building team. The design of these systems has become the standard for storefront systems in high velocity hurricane zones.

Impact Resistance – Tested for large- and small-missile hurricane impact in accordance with TAS and ASTM E1886.
Air Infiltration (ASTM E283) – Meets strict air leakage limits for enhanced envelope performance.
Water Resistance (ASTM E331 / AAMA 501) – No uncontrolled water infiltration under specified pressures.
Structural Performance (ASTM E330) – Rated for extreme wind pressures without permanent deformation or glass failure.
Thermal Performance – Compatible with insulated glass for energy efficiency in hurricane-prone regions.
